Transaction c86b2ff41efecfe1676383ea13fc4b38ad786e53f34c2c887a9af8a9ad3213c1

1 Input
2 Outputs
  • c86b2ff41efecfe1676383ea13fc4b38ad786e53f34c2c887a9af8a9ad3213c1:0
  • value  1534596
    address  38KftKyS2LwLescaKcRDtVYyEvFqG2Gcxr
  • c86b2ff41efecfe1676383ea13fc4b38ad786e53f34c2c887a9af8a9ad3213c1:1
  • value  34580240
    address  3AfmGuRG7zWrE5HowBDKBme4DyuiACvrnW